视觉识别程序主要包括以下几个方面:
定位功能:
自动判断产品所在位置,并将位置信息通过通讯协议输出。
在线检测功能:
检测产品表面的相关信息,例如印刷有无错误、表面缺陷破损、有无油污灰尘等。
测量功能:
自动测量产品外观尺寸、外形轮廓度、高度、面积和孔径等。
图像分类 (Image Classification):通过算法将图像分为不同的类别。目标检测
(Object Detection):识别图像中的目标物体及其位置。
目标定位(Object Localization):精确确定目标物体在图像中的位置。
实例分割(Instance Segmentation):将图像中的每个目标物体分割出来,区分不同的实例。
人体姿态估计(Human Pose Estimation):识别图像中人体的关键点,例如关节位置和方向。
深度估计(Depth Estimation):预测图像中物体的深度信息。
分割提案(Segment Proposal):生成可能的分割区域,用于后续的分割任务。
特征提取:
通过卷积神经网络(CNN)等方法提取图像特征。
反馈再加工阶段:
在设计开发阶段之后,根据反馈对系统进行再加工和优化。
编制指导手册阶段:
编写指导手册,帮助用户更好地理解和使用视觉识别系统。
这些功能可以应用于不同的场景,例如工业自动化、视频监控、医疗诊断、自动驾驶等。通过这些程序,可以大大提高识别的准确性和效率,从而在各种实际应用中发挥重要作用。